Public Title of Study   Clinical study assessing safety and effectiveness of medicine containing two antiemetic drugs (Fosnetupitant 235 mg and Palonosetron 0.25 mg) when they are administered intravenously to prevent nausea and vomiting in cancer patients receiving chemotherapy cycles.  
Scientific Title of Study   An open label, single arm, multicenter, prospective study to evaluate safety and effectiveness of Akynzeo® I.V. [Fosnetupitant 235 mg and Palonosetron 0.25 mg (concentrate for solution for infusion)], in the prevention of chemotherapy induced nausea and vomiting (CINV) in Indian patients (STOP-CINV study)

Inclusion Criteria  
Age From  18.00 Year(s)
Age To  75.00 Year(s)
Gender  Both 
Details  1. Patient is scheduled to receive their first chemotherapy cycle of a highly
emetogenic or a moderately emetogenic chemotherapy (HEC/MEC).
2. Male/female patients aged above more than or equal to 18 years to less than or equal to 75 years
3. Willing to be part of study and for follow up.
4. Willing to provide written informed consent form.  
 
ExclusionCriteria 
Details  1. Patients with serious cardiovascular disease history or predisposition to
cardiac conduction abnormalities or use of medication which can cause
conduction abnormalities as per treating physicians’ assessment.
2. Vomiting, retching, or more than no significant nausea within 24 h before
the informed consent.
3. Women of child bearing potential who are pregnant, planning to becoming
pregnant or breast feeding.
4. Known contraindication to the intravenous administration of 50 mL 5%
glucose solution prior to index date
5. Hypersensitivity to active substances or excipients of Akynzeo® I.V.
6. Patient currently enrolled in another clinical trial.
7. Patients requiring multi-day chemotherapy
8. Patients who are prescribed other NK1RA and 5 HT3 RA

Primary Outcome  
Outcome  TimePoints 
-Number of patients with drug related treatment emergent adverse events (TEAEs) as
assessed by the treating physician
-Number of patients with TEAEs
-Number of patients with Serious TEAEs (STEAEs)
 
[Time Frame: up to 240 hr (10 days]
 
 
Secondary Outcome  
Outcome  TimePoints 
1. Complete response rate (CR: no emesis, no rescue medication) during acute phase
2. Complete response rate during delayed phase
3. Complete response rate during the overall phase
4. Complete control (CC: no emesis, no rescue medication, and no nausea) during
overall phase
5. Complete protection (CP: no emesis, no rescue medication and no significant
nausea) during overall phase
6. Complete response rate during extended overall phase.
7. Severity of nausea assessed using a Visual Analogue Scale (VAS) 

1.[Time Frame: 0 to 24 hrs.(10 days)]
2.[Time Frame: 24 to 120 hrs.]
3.[Time Frame: 0 to 120 hrs.]
4.[Time Frame: 0 to 120 hrs.]

5.[Time Frame: 0 to 120 hrs.]

6.[Time Frame: 0 to 240 hrs(10 days)]
7.[Time Frame: upto 240 hr (10 days)]

Brief Summary   The study is a prospective, open label, multicenter, single arm, phase IV study to evaluate the safety and effectiveness of Akynzeo® I.V. in the management of patients receiving highly emetogenic chemotherapy (HEC)/ moderately emetogenic chemotherapy (MEC) regimen for the prevention of CINV among Indian patients. The study would be initiated at each site after review and approval from ethics committee (IRB/IEC). At screening & baseline, the potential patients both male, female more than or equal to 18 years of age, scheduled for first cycle of chemotherapy, will be enrolled in the study and a written informed consent would be procured before any study related procedures are undertaken. A detailed medical history will be obtained and also physical examination will be conducted for each patient by the study investigators. The clinical and laboratory assessment as per schedule of assessments (Table 2) would be performed at screening for determining the eligibility. Subjects would be administered the study drug on site by the Investigator and Visual Analog Scale (VAS) handout will be given to the patient.
